Kyphoplasty is a minimally invasive surgical procedure used to treat vertebral compression fractures in the spine. This surgery is performed to relieve pain, stabilize the fractured vertebra, and restore vertebral height. During the procedure, a small incision is made, and a narrow tube called a trocar is inserted into the affected vertebra. A specialized balloon is then inserted through the trocar and inflated inside the vertebra to create a cavity. The balloon is deflated and removed, and medical-grade bone cement is injected into the cavity to stabilize the fractured vertebra.
Kyphoplasty is primarily used to treat vertebral compression fractures caused by osteoporosis, a condition that weakens the bones, making them susceptible to fractures. It can also be used to treat fractures resulting from spinal tumors or trauma.
The recovery process after a kyphoplasty procedure is typically relatively quick. Patients may experience immediate pain relief or a significant reduction in pain. They are usually able to get up and walk within a few hours after the procedure. The hospital stay is generally short, and most patients are discharged on the same day or the following day. Some discomfort or soreness at the incision site may be experienced, but it typically resolves within a few days. Physical activity and strenuous exercises may need to be limited for a few weeks to allow the vertebral cement to fully harden. Your care provider will give you specific instructions regarding medication, activity restrictions, and follow-up appointments.
